More about this course
  • In this three-module path, teachers and administrators learn how pedagogy needs to shift from the techniques used in a face-to-face environment and how Office 365 and Microsoft Teams can be leveraged to empower student-centered learning in the remote classroom
  • This course explores the considerations, procedures, and planning that administrators and educators will need to examine in preparation for a remote learning experience
  • Educators will learn how to use Microsoft Teams, Stream, OneNote Class Notebook, and Flipgrid to engage students and foster connections with the school community from afar
  • Learn to teach with the accessibility tools in Windows 10, Office 365, and apps including Teams, Immersive Reader, Math Tools, Word, Translator, and OneNote
